Household of Susanna Margarieta Zwanenburg

She is married to Cornelis van der Voorden.

They got married on November 13, 1895 at Rotterdam, Zuid-Holland, Nederland, she was 23 years old.

Sources

  1. BS Huwelijks register van Susanna Margarietha Zwanenburg
  2. Archiefnaam: Rotterdam
    Archief: Rotterdam
    Bruidegom Cornelis van der Voorden, geb. Schoonhoven 22 jaar
    Vader Willem van der Voorden
    Moeder Wilhelmina Hogendoorn
    Bruid Susanna Margarietha Zwanenburg, geb. Kralingen 23 jaar
    Vader Pieter Johannes Zwanenburg
    Moeder Adriana Stijnen
    Plaats Rotterdam
    Huwelijksdatum 13-11-1895
    Opmerkingen akte nr. 1459
    Bron Rotterdam 1895 k056
    November 13, 1895
  3. Geboorteakte Susanna Margrietha Zwanenburg
  4. Archiefnaam: Nationaal Archief (Rijksarchief Zuid-Hollan
    Deel/Akte: 199
    Bron Burgerlijke stand - Geboorte
    Archieflocatie Nationaal Archief (Rijksarchief Zuid-Holland)
    Algemeen Gemeente: Kralingen
    Soort akte: Geboorteakte
    Aktenummer: 199
    Aangiftedatum: 11-06-1872
    Kind Susanna Margrietha Zwanenburg
    Geslacht: V
    Vondeling: N
    Geboortedatum: 10-06-1872
    Geboorteplaats: Kralingen
    Vader Pieter Johannes Zwanenburg
    Moeder Adriana Stijnen
    June 11, 1872
